These structures differ from the system state since they relate to static components of the system (all processes which existed instead of just the currently existing processes). The basic attributes tree to gather for several different execution modes (e.g., user mode, syscall, irq), thereafter called the "events tree", contains the following attributes: the number of events of each type, the total number of events, the number of bytes written, the time spent executing, waiting for a resource, waiting for a cpu, and possibly many others. The name "facility-event_type" below is to be replaced by specific event types (e.g., core-schedchange, code-syscall_entry...). event_types/ "facility-event_type" events_count cpu_time cumulative_cpu_time elapsed_time wait_time bytes_written packets_sent ... The events for several different execution modes are joined together to form the "execution modes tree". The name "execution mode" is to be replaced by "system call", "trap", "irq", "user mode" or "kernel thread". The name "submode" is to be replaced by the specific system call, trap or irq name. The "submode" is an empty string if none is applicable, which is the case for "user mode" and "kernel thread". An "events tree" for each "execution mode" contains the sum for all its different submodes. An "events tree" in the "execution modes tree" contains the sum for all its different execution modes. mode_types/ "execution mode"/ submodes/ "submode"/ Events Tree events/ Event Tree events/ Events Tree Each trace set contains an "execution modes tree". While the traces come from possibly different systems, which may differ in their system calls..., most of the system calls will have the same name, even if their actual internal numeric id differs. Categories such as cpu id and process id are not kept since these are specific to each system. When several traces are taken from the same system, these categories may make sense and could eventually be considered. Each trace contains a global "execution modes tree", one for each cpu and process, and one for each process/cpu combination. The name "cpu number" stands for the cpu identifier, and "process_id-start_time" is a unique process identifier composed of the process id (unique at any given time but which may be reused over time) concatenated with the process start time. Each process has a "functions" tree which contains each process'function address (when the information is available). To achieve this efficiently, each tracefile context contains a pointer to the current relevant "events tree" and "event_types" tree within it. Once all the events are processed, the total number of events is computed within each trace/processes/ * /cpu/ * /functions/ * /mode_types/ * /submodes/ *. Then, the "events tree" are summed for all submodes within each mode type and for all mode types within a processes/ * /cpu/ * /functions/ * "execution modes tree". Then, the "execution modes trees" for all functions within a trace/processes/ * /cpu for all cpu within a process, for all processes, and for all traces are computed. Separately, the "execution modes tree" for each function (over all cpus) for all processes, and for all traces are summed in the trace/processes/ * /functions/ * subtree. Finally, the "execution modes trees" for all cpu within a process, for all processes, and for all traces are computed.
